Transaction 2075d58fa96ca70fee688c2bc04be8bb55fb9fab15678b358c224bb3b4072e27

1 Input
1 Outputs
  • 2075d58fa96ca70fee688c2bc04be8bb55fb9fab15678b358c224bb3b4072e27:0
  • value  742622
    address  3MiMsH5zYdDGSzooQWeebwmNf7nJcM4bWM